GNU bug report logs - #39728
[PATCH] Allow parallel downloads and builds

Previous Next

Package: guix-patches;

Reported by: Julien Lepiller <julien <at> lepiller.eu>

Date: Fri, 21 Feb 2020 22:54:02 UTC

Severity: normal

Tags: patch

Full log


Message #20 received at 39728 <at> debbugs.gnu.org (full text, mbox):

From: Maxim Cournoyer <maxim.cournoyer <at> gmail.com>
To: Julien Lepiller <julien <at> lepiller.eu>
Cc: 39728 <at> debbugs.gnu.org
Subject: Re: bug#39728: [PATCH] Allow parallel downloads and builds
Date: Tue, 13 Jul 2021 22:49:02 -0400
Hello!

Julien Lepiller <julien <at> lepiller.eu> writes:

> Hi guix!
>
> This patch allows to count builds and downloads separately. The idea is
> that downloads need bandwidth, but no CPU, while builds do not need
> bandwidth, but need CPU. With this patch, guix will be able to download
> substitutes while building unrelated packages. Currently, guix needs to
> wait for the download to finish before proceeding to the build. This
> should reduce the time of guix commands that need to build and download
> things at the same time.
>
> What do you think?

Looks like a neat improvement!  Could you provide a follow-up to
Ludovic's review?  It seems not much is missing (minor cosmetic changes
to commit messages + code and more importantly, the accompanying
documentation update).

Thank you!

Maxim




This bug report was last modified 3 years and 201 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.